Coastal wattle

Coastal wattle (Acacia cyclops) is a dense, fast-growing shrub in the family Fabaceae, native to the southwestern and southern coastal regions of Western Australia, from Shark Bay south to the Nullarbor Plain. It grows on coastal dunes, sandy scrubland, and limestone substrates near the sea, where it tolerates salt spray, wind, and summer drought. Coastal wattle produces distinctive circular seeds with bright red arillate coatings, making them highly attractive to birds. Although valued in its native range for coastal stabilisation and revegetation, the species has become highly invasive in southern Africa, particularly South Africa, where it was introduced for dune stabilisation in the 19th century and has since spread extensively across the Cape Floristic Region, displacing native fynbos vegetation. It is listed among the 100 worst invasive species globally by the IUCN Invasive Species Specialist Group. In Australia, it is assessed as Least Concern. Management of invasive populations in South Africa involves mechanical removal and biological control efforts aimed at protecting the critically threatened fynbos biome.

Common Eastern Wildrye

<em>Elymus virginicus</em>, the common eastern wildrye, is a native North American grass in the family Poaceae, currently not evaluated by the IUCN Red List. The species is documented in Denmark, Sweden, and the United States, and typically inhabits grasslands, wetlands, forests, and cultivated lands across its range in eastern and central North America. It is a cool-season, perennial bunchgrass that typically grows in moist to mesic habitats including riverbanks, floodplain woodlands, forest understories, and moist prairies. <em>Elymus virginicus</em> is recognized by its distinctive nodding seed heads with stiff, curved awns and is among the most widely distributed wild rye grasses in North America. The species provides important ecosystem services as a native ground cover, stabilizing streambanks and riparian soils against erosion, and offering habitat and food resources for grassland birds, small mammals, and invertebrates. Common eastern wildrye is also valued in ecological restoration projects for its adaptability to a range of soil conditions and its ability to establish quickly in disturbed habitats. As a forage grass, it is moderately palatable to livestock and wildlife. Biological traits of this species remain poorly documented in the scientific literature.
